Packing Up and Moving Your Data

In our age of technology and communication it is common that our customers are adopting RiteTrack after using another data management system, often for a substantial amount of time. One of the largest concerns that we deal with is, “Will we get to keep our data and will it be complete?” At Handel, we understand that historical information is invaluable to spot trends, maintain reporting requirements, and increase interdepartmental communication. That is why we have developed proprietary software to quickly and accurately convert legacy data into RiteTrack.

Our data conversion process starts at the very beginning of our project management process; Handel views data conversions as a key and central part of our software implementations, not as an afterthought. Our trained project managers begin by explicitly mapping out each column in every table in the legacy database and define a place for it to go in the new RiteTrack system. This process takes place alongside the creation of the system design so that the mapping is completed before we start developing the system in order to make certain that no crucial data is left behind. During this process your project manager will highlight areas where the legacy data may not be clean or accurate so that no dirty information finds its way into the new system.

While on the initial site visit, your project manager will sit down with you and your staff to walk through your legacy system to gain a full understanding of its functionality, how your staff uses it, and any potential difficulties that may arise in the conversion process. Since every system is different we make sure to take the time to get to know it. This practice gets to the core of how Handel does business; each project and each customer is unique and we dedicate ourselves to forming a relationship based upon communication, transparency, and honesty.

Once a conversion map has been completed and approved, the data will begin the process of being moved into RiteTrack. Our skilled developers have built software to assist us in the conversion process. Using this single core technology reduces errors, speeds up the conversion process, and lowers cost. Our data conversion experts work side-by-side with our project managers throughout the entire project to make sure that this process is as streamlined as possible.

Much like our software development, our data conversion process involves multiple rounds of testing and validating to make sure that the end product is exactly what it should be. You and your staff will be able to see and test the converted data in a sandbox version of RiteTrack, this will even include any custom fields that have been added. For larger systems this is often done in phases to ensure that nothing is missed in the sheer volume of information we work with.

Finally, when the entire data conversion has been tested and approved, Handel will pull a final and current copy of the legacy database for conversion. This information will be what eventually comprises your initial RiteTrack system. At the end of this process your users will have a new, friendly, and easy-to-use software solution complete with all of the data that has been tirelessly entered by users in the legacy system.

This simple, yet powerful, methodology, when paired with our proprietary software, takes the often frustrating and error-prone process of converting data and turns it into an efficient and organized procedure. What is more, our data conversions are fully supported just like our software. If there is an issue found after RiteTrack has gone live our data conversion experts will rectify the error, often with zero downtime for users. Reaching Your Clients: The Importance of Address Verification

Often one of the most frustrating experiences a user of enterprise software can have is the inability to track address information in a consistent and reliable way. This arises mostly due to the fact that most software systems don’t verify address information, which leaves the formatting of an address up to each individual user. This “free form” system of entering data can seem to make a system more flexible, but in reality it creates a large amount of unusable data.

To provide an illustration, below are some examples of the issues that we have run into in our data conversions when organizations upgrade to RiteTrack:

  • Incomplete, invalid, or missing zip codes
  • Street address with no street name
  • Descriptive text that is not an address such as ‘Incarcerated’, ‘Unknown’, or, my personal favorite, ‘I Do Not Know’

All of these issues lead to one common problem; addresses in most databases cannot be readily trusted to be accurate. During data conversions from legacy systems to RiteTrack, we often identify that up to 50% of addresses that were entered into an outdated system are incomplete, inaccurate, or not even an address. Luckily, there is one common solution to solve this problem. That answer is address verification.

RiteTrack utilizes the power of Google Maps to verify addresses, help complete missing information, and keep consistent formatting in the addresses that users track. This single solution, using Google’s API, leads to more accurate reporting, reduced data entry time, and, most importantly, a database that can be trusted.
